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
98877291262 59288782 3072391 1760
1226 504756668 99890014
1226 504756668 99890014
9201 973989270 6509496 999625777
All about undefined
Interested in learning more?
1226 504756668 99890014
9201 973989270 6509496 999625777
See more
78483 0805 723576
6252 50 2631
See more
620790 580
84 730 38349807 34 028337999
See more